Where is Hotel Sirenetta, Isola delle Femmine?
Where is Hotel Sirenetta, Isola delle Femmine located?
Hotel Sirenetta, Isola delle Femmine, Sicilia, Italy (approx. 38.18618°, 13.23883°)
Where is Hotel Sirenetta, Isola delle Femmine on the map?
{"latitude":38.18618,"longitude":13.23883,"title":"Hotel Sirenetta, Isola delle Femmine"}